Christensen Agate marbles examples and Identification tips. In this video we discuss the Christensen Agate Company and explore Identification tips to their vintage glass marbles.

So much great information, thank you! Can you tell me what size range Christensen made their marbles please? And if any are UV reactive?
@stephenbahrmarbles
@stephenbahrmarbles Год назад
Hi Kitty Kat and thank you. Most Christensens stay around 9/16” - 5/8” . Their slags can be found at around 3/4” . The yellow glass on their swirls can often glow orange, and their white glass May glow green. I hope that helps !
